Description
 
Surmont Phase 1 is an in-situ SAGD project consisting of a 27,000bbl/d central processing facility, with two pads, 36 horizontal well pairs and a network of vertical observation wells.  The Production Engineer is responsible for managing and optimizing the well pads, observation wells, water source and disposal wells and any associated surface facilities. The Production Engineer will be responsible for ensuring optimal production rates and revenue generation for the Surmont Phase 1 project.

Responsibilities

  • Support and comply with the policies, goals, efforts, and programs of CPC's Health, Safety and Environmental (HSE) Management System
  • Provide production engineering expertise within a multi-disciplinary team to monitor, analyze and optimize SAGD well production
  • Collaborate with both Field Operations and Reservoir Engineering to ensure adequate field surveillance and production data integrity
  • Optimize artificial lift (Gas Lift, ESP and PCP) and manage well servicing or workovers
  • Troubleshoot surface facility issues (separation, metering, etc)
  • Plan and manage well interventions, ESP/PCP conversions, new well completions and maintenance workovers
  • Plan and manage new well start ups (steam circulation phase and SAGD phases)
  • Support the development of a well integrity program
  • Mentor junior production engineering staff
  • Provide support to the Surmont Phase 2 execution team
  • Project Management
  • Prepare and manage budget forecasts
  • Support Operations Excellence initiatives
  • Identify and recommend new technologies to improve the SAGD recovery process
  • Establish and maintain relationships with various stakeholders.
  • Provide periodic updates to internal management and Joint Venture partners
  • Actively participate of the department’s Knowledge Sharing activities
  • This role will require approximately 10% travel to our Surmont Facility
